Paddle Skedaddle (Up the Creek in British English) is a General mini-game in Mario Party: Island Tour.
Introduction
In the Demo, Blue Toad is seen demonstrating how to paddle left and right.
Gameplay
The players race through a creek in canoes. The first portion of the race is a mountainous area. The second portion is a desert, while the third one is a grassland. The final portion is a beach-themed area, with a bridge which players jump onto after crossing the finish line. The first person to cross the finish line is the winner.

In-game text
- Rules – American English "Race to the finish by paddling your canoe through the winding stream."
- Rules – British English "Navigate the course in your canoe, and reach the finish line."
